Taxonomic Classification

Rank Guaira Spiny-rat Streak-capped Treehunter
Kingdom same Animalia (Animals) Animalia (Animals)
Phylum same Chordata (Chordates) Chordata (Chordates)
Class Mammalia (Mammals) Aves (Birds)
Order Rodentia (Rodents) Passeriformes (Songbirds)
Family Echimyidae Furnariidae
Genus Proechimys Thripadectes
Species Proechimys guairae Thripadectes virgaticeps

Evolutionary Relationship

Guaira Spiny-rat and Streak-capped Treehunter share a common ancestor at the Phylum level: Chordata. (Chordates)
